Civil regulation goes every one of the way back to Roman periods when Emperor Justinian codified each of the Empire’s laws in the sixth century CE. Civil legislation was get more info subsequently revived in A lot of Medieval Europe and serves as the muse for that authorized techniques of nations like France, Spain, and Portugal, coupled with quite a few of their previous colonies, including the province of Quebec plus the point out of Louisiana (which both equally exist in countries which have been normally dominated by common regulation tradition). Civil legislation has also been used by non-European international locations that were in no way colonized, like Russia and Japan, as the basis of their particular authorized reforms.
